WebBackground. Slow weight gain describes a child or infant whose current weight, or rate of weight gain is significantly below that expected for age and sex, or if weight has dropped ≥2 major percentile lines. Slow weight gain may indicate inadequate growth for health and development and should trigger a medical and psychosocial assessment. WebAlthough children with growth hormone deficiency grow slowly, they grow in proportion – that is, the length of their arms and legs stay at the same ratio to their chest and abdomen. Their face may also look younger than their actual age. They may seem chubbier than other children – this is due to the effect of growth hormone on fat storage ... Growth hormone deficiency (GHD) in children is a rare but treatable cause of growth failure in children. Growth hormone (GH) also has effects on bone mineral density, body composition, metabolic profile, and quality of life. May be isolated (IGHD) or combined with other anterior and/or posterior pituitary hormone deficiencies (CPHD).
